Boston Phoenix
Review: Straw Dogs
Published 9/23/2011 by MICHAEL ATKINSON
Rod Lurie's new version of the Peckinpah classic
Boston Phoenix
Moronic PETA activists strip naked, clown about a serious issue
Published 5/24/2011 by Jeff Inglis
I'm no fan of animal cruelty. Which is why I hate PETA. They're unduly cruel and ridiculous to their fellow animals (the human kind) in...